Manufacturing Intern
4 months ago
A position at White Cap isn’t your ordinary job. You’ll work in an exciting and diverse environment, meet interesting people, and have a variety of career opportunities. The White Cap family is committed to Building Trust on Every Job. We do this by being deeply knowledgeable, fully capable, and always dependable, and our associates are the driving force behind this commitment.
**WHAT WE HAVE TO OFFER**:
- 70+ Locations across Canada.
- Career Development Opportunities.
- Monday to Friday, Day Shifts.
- And more
**Job Summary**
Gain hands-on experience in areas such as marketing, human resources, information technology, sales, operations, finance, logistics, business development, merchandising, and/or other departments.
**Major Tasks, Responsibilities, and Key Accountabilities**
- Prepares and delivers insights and recommendations based on analyses.
- Produces findings and draws conclusions from analyses. Makes oral and written recommendations to management.
- Executes tasks directly related to functional projects and/or process improvements.
- Communicates issues and roadblocks related to areas of responsibility.
- May assist in research or special projects in a variety of areas in order to fulfill business initiatives and meet business objectives.
**Nature and Scope**
- Works in compliance with established procedures and/or protocols. Identifies and resolves readily identifiable, clearly defined problems. Demonstrates skill in data analysis and techniques by resolving missing/incomplete information and inconsistencies/anomalies in routine research/data.
- Nature of work requires general supervision; exercises judgment. May be paired with a mentor. Work typically involves regular process checks or review of output by a coworker and/or supervisor.
- May provide general guidance/direction to or train junior level support personnel.
**Work Environment**
- Located in a comfortable indoor area. Any unpleasant conditions would be infrequent and not objectionable.
- Frequent periods are spent standing or sitting in the same location with some opportunity to move about. Occasionally there may be a requirement to stoop or lift light material or equipment (typically less than 8 pounds).
- Typically requires overnight travel less than 10% of the time.
**Education and Experience**
- Typically requires BS/BA in a related discipline. Certification may be required in some areas. Generally 0-2 years of experience in a related field OR MS/MA and generally 0-1 year of experience in a related field.
